About the Book
Aubrey Grace Lenerose loves her grandparents. And her grandparents so love her. But it’s not until she is three that she is finally allowed to travel back home with them for a ten-day visit. Mimi and Pa Pa are so excited to have her there, they have planned ten wonderfully exciting, adventurous, and fun-packed days to keep her busy and keep them all entertained. This special, first visit may leave Aubrey’s grandparents a bit tired, but it is enjoyed to the fullest. As Aubrey counts through the days of the week, she helps others learn to count to ten too. This endearing, sweet story shares the loving relationship between a grandparent and a grandchild, and it’s even illustrated by Aubrey herself.
About the Author
Debbie Baker Williams began writing stories for her grandchildren as they were born. With both her father and her husband retired from the U.S. Armed Forces, she has traveled and lived in many places, including Florida, Virginia, Oregon, North Dakota, Texas, and even the Netherlands, where her first two children were born. They now have four grown children and five grandchildren. Debbie has taught both elementary and secondary school for more than twenty years in Texas. She currently serves as a School Library Media Specialist within the Amarillo Independent School District in Amarillo, Texas. Presently, Debbie resides with her husband in Canyon, Texas. Ten Days With Mimi and Pa Pa is her first story, written for their first grandchild. Their daughter and her family now reside in Canyon as well. So now Aubrey, along with her younger brother Landon, can visit Mimi and Pa Pa most any day they wish.
